Today I wanted to share even more of the backstory of my show.
In late 2009 I was contacted by a group that wanted to have an all woman internet radio show. With a bunch of different topics. The webmaster for the organization is a quilter and she told them to contact me to see if I would be interested.
In 2009 there were not many internet radio shows, I had a bit of research to do! After looking into it I talked with the owner of the Toginet Radio Station.
One of the interesting questions he asked me was 'do you think you can talk about Quilting for a full hour?'.
My First show was January 18, 2010
Well 5 years later, I can safely say that that with 283 shows recorded...yes I can talk quilting! And I can talk for an hour almost every week for those 5 years.
I totally love this part of my job. I have amazing partners in American Patchwork & Quilting Magazine and Moda Fabrics.
Going into my 6th year I have over the 200,000 subscribers... WOW.. yes.. all those zeros are right! And sometimes a quarter of a million people listen.

Let me give you a brief 'what is this'
- This is internet Radio, that is all recorded. JUST like NPR Radio (Fresh Air is my Favorite) BUT... without all the staff and editing.... wink!
- My shows are recorded so you can subscribe or listen online
- I find all the guests myself
- I write all the guests
- The day of the show, the station calls me on skype, then calls each guest on by phone, and sometimes by skype
- After the show I get the recording and pull out quotes for the American Patchwork & Quilting Website
- I write to all the guests, and let you know the show is live!
